Can I delete all promotions in Gmail at once?

Gmail, one of the most popular email services, offers a wide range of features to help users manage their emails efficiently. However, with the increasing number of promotional emails, it can become quite cumbersome to manually delete them one by one. In this article, we will discuss how you can delete all promotions in Gmail at once, saving you time and effort.

Using the Select All Option

One of the simplest ways to delete all promotions in Gmail at once is by using the Select All option. Here’s how you can do it:

1. Log in to your Gmail account.
2. Click on the “Promotions” tab on the left-hand side of the screen.
3. Scroll through the emails until you find the first promotional email.
4. Click on the checkbox next to the first email to select it.
5. Now, hold down the Shift key on your keyboard and click on the checkbox next to the last promotional email. This will select all the promotional emails in the list.
6. Once all the promotional emails are selected, click on the “Delete” button at the top of the screen.

Using the Search Operator

Another method to delete all promotions in Gmail at once is by using the search operator. Here’s how you can do it:

1. Log in to your Gmail account.
2. Click on the search bar at the top of the screen.
3. Type “label:promotions” (without the quotes) in the search bar and press Enter.
4. This will display all the promotional emails in your inbox.
5. Click on the checkbox next to the first email to select it.
6. Hold down the Shift key on your keyboard and click on the checkbox next to the last promotional email to select all of them.
7. Click on the “Delete” button at the top of the screen.
